WebFeb 21, 2024 · But for someone with anxiety, too much stimulation from caffeine can lead to jitteriness and restlessness and even trigger an anxiety attack. Between coffee and tea, coffee might make things worse. A 240ml cup of coffee gives around 96 mg of caffeine. But in the same cup, tea would yield only about 29 mg of it. WebJun 27, 2024 · Does weak coffee have less caffeine? But does weak coffee really contain less caffeine? If you consider that the strength of the coffee is determined by its coffee-to-water ratio, then, yes, weak coffee does contain less caffeine When coffee is brewed with a lower coffee-to-water ratio, less caffeine will be present in each cup. ...
